Description
1864 1C Bronze No L MS65 Red PCGS. Snow-7. The crossbar of the 4 in the date is broadly repunched. A lustrous Gem with pumpkin-orange color and no detectable contact. An infrequent carbon fleck does not challenge the grade. A small piece of the lower back of the holder has broken off, this does not affect the coin or the holder's integrity.From The Rafael Romero Collection.(#2078) (Registry values: N1793)
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 227L, PCGS# 2078, GSID# 1298)
Metal: 95% Copper, 5% Tin & Zinc
Weight: 3.11 grams
Weight: 0.10422oz
Mintage: 39,233,714
